Output 03ae56a88c869be31132cd43e47169b0dcb0418681b07752994a74198a8422ae:20

value
143887452
script pubkey
OP_0 OP_PUSHBYTES_32 2079d989986eeebe7b2571d27a7fbf5644ecc0bb80fe4b386613e99bc36af742
address
bc1qypuanzvcdmhtu7e9w8f85lal2ezwes9msrlykwrxz05ehsm27apqd8wa5e
transaction
03ae56a88c869be31132cd43e47169b0dcb0418681b07752994a74198a8422ae
spent
true